In an extreme environment, such as Mars or a volcanic area, mobile robots have been used in scientific missions, or as precursors for a future manned mission. The robot called a <italic xmlns:mml="http://www.w3.org/1998/Math/MathML" xmlns:xlink="http://www.w3.org/1999/xlink">planetary exploration rover</i> is managed by a space-qualified, radiation-hardened, and low-clock onboard computer, and autonomously travels over challenging terrain.
